Josephine Hopper – An Artistic Force in Her Own Right with Elizabeth Colleary
Josephine Nivison Hopper, wife of famed painter Edward Hopper, was an accomplished artist whose works were thought to be primarily lost. While visiting Florida in 2000. Elizabeth Colleary met with Arthayer Sanborn, a friend of the Hoppers, who revealed a large box of watercolors bequeathed to him by Josephine.
Elizabeth Colleary, an art historian and renowned Hopper scholar, discovered more of Mrs. Hoppers’s work stored at the Whitney Museum in New York. Ms Colleary is a sought-after speaker on the life and works of Josephine Hopper and the Hoppers’ sometimes tumultuous relationship here in Truro.
